Scope and Contents
Telegram from WSC to the Duke of Windsor [formerly King Edward VIII] marked "most secret and personal" and "To be deciphered by his Personal Private Secretary only " stating that he has laid his wish before the King [George VI] who is not prepared to take any action and stating that it would be impossible for him [WSC] to move the War Cabinet in that direction and that he would "deprecate even bringing the matter before them." Initialled.
